On Wednesday, a Russian court sentenced a journalist to six years in prison for criticizing her on social media. Instagram Russian attack on Ukraine.
Maria Ponomarenko, 44, was found guilty of “spreading false information” about the army, Russian judicial authorities said.
The law, which was passed in the wake of Russia’s new military campaign in Ukraine, has already been used several times to sentence people who publicly criticize the conflict to long prison terms.
The journalist was convicted by a court in Barnaul, Siberian Altai Territory, where she worked for the news portal RusNews.
According to the public organization OVD-Info, the journalist was accused after publishing a message on the social network in March last year. Instagram condemning the bombing of a theater hall in the Ukrainian city of Mariupol during a siege by Russian troops.
Kyiv accused Moscow of being responsible for the deaths of hundreds of civilians in the explosion of the building.
Russia denies the accusations.
Maria Ponomarenko was arrested in April 2022 in St. Petersburg and then transferred to Barnaul.
The journalist’s lawyer said that Ponomarenko’s psychological condition worsened during the months of detention, in which the authorities refused to transfer her to a psychiatric hospital.
According to OVD-Info, in September last year, the journalist broke the window of the cell where she was kept, because the glass “was so opaque” that it did not let in sunlight.
As punishment, she was placed in a punishment cell for a week.
In November, she was allowed to remain under house arrest at her ex-husband’s residence, but after an argument in late January, the journalist was again transferred to a prison in Siberia.
